        Nashville is a tough team to beat at home and if they dont take useless penalties like they did against dallas on sunday they will win. Pekka Rinne should be back in nets for them tonight. This will be a good test for Detroit, they will be facing a hot team that plays with a strict system. If you examine detroit's latest wins; vs edm, edmonton just lost vysnovsky for the year a d-man loging 23-24min a game and had horcoff out because of inj. @pit, Despite having crosby and malikin Pitsburgh has one of the worst records of the league since december.
